What Are HTM71 Modular Storage Systems?

What Are HTM71 Modular Storage Systems

Hospitals, health care centres, and other medical facilities deal with people’s lives daily. They are all fast-paced work environments that require easy and immediate access to materials, information, and supplies to ensure quality and promptness in their service. Having an organised and modular storage solution can help speed up work and lessen the stress among employees. 

One of the commonly used healthcare and medical storage solutions you would find in these settings is the HTM71 (Health Technical Memorandum 71). It is recognised as one of the best solutions in medical environments because of its ease of use and effective utilisation of the available allotted space. 

Part of the healthcare professionals’ duties is to provide efficient storage for medical supplies to serve their clients and patients better—and HTM71 helps them achieve just that!

What the HTM71 Modular Storage System Looks Like

Back in the days, static storage solutions were vastly used in medical settings. This setup resulted in moving products from one storage unit to where they are needed and back, depending on work demands. The whole process of transporting these delicate items back and forth exposes them to possible risks, such as damage, contamination, and the chance for things to get lost. 

The HTM71 storage solution helps prevent these situations because it comes with stackable trays that anyone can quickly move, transport, and bring back. All products are safely placed inside the tray, so all items are together, minimising the risk of getting them lost or damaged in the process. Having a tray also reduces the risks of the implements in them coming into direct contact with unsanitised hands, thus lessening the possibility for contamination. 

On Material and Capacity

PP Healthcare Solutions’ HTM71 follows the NHS’s (National Health Service) health building notes. Each basket of this modular storage can accommodate loads of up to 25 kg, while the medications module can carry up to 15 kg. They are made of a solid base that prevents fluids from escaping and dust from entering. 

In PP Healthcare Solutions, we offer the products in two different finishes. You can choose a light blue module in ABS plastic material that is resistant to temperatures of up to 85 degrees Celsius or opt for a clear version made of polycarbonate if you need a module that can resist temperatures of up to 121 degrees Celsius. 

On Usage

Safety is guaranteed for all products placed in HTM71 storage. Every basket comes with easy slots for lengthwise and crosswise dividers, making storing differently-sized items easier to manage. Items would not roll inside each container whether you tilt the baskets or transport it to other locations because of these flexible dividers. 

Labelling is also not an issue with HTM71. There are available label slots you can push and clip on any side of the basket, whether you use the dividers lengthwise or crosswise. 

Moreover, all of these baskets are easily sterilisable. They can be arranged for mounting on walls or stacking on panels—making them increasingly useful in such a delicate and time-sensitive environment as a hospital.
